Many people with sensitive skin struggle to maintain the skin’s healthy, protective barrier. This barrier keeps moisture in and keeps external irritants and allergens out. When the skin’s barrier is damaged, moisture seeps out, and environmental irritants can penetrate deeper into the skin, causing inflammation and irritation. Developing Your Complete Sensitive Skincare Routine

A great moisturizer is an important skincare step that can help to alleviate many sensitive skin symptoms. However, choosing the right moisturizer is only one part of creating the ideal skincare routine for sensitive skin. Each person is different, so you should work with a dermatologist to create the perfect skincare routine. Below, we’ve put together a basic AM and PM skincare routine to help reduce skin sensitivity and improve the overall appearance and health of sensitive skin.

Your Sensitive Skin AM Skincare RoutineBest Derm Skincare Face Moisturizers for Sensitive Skin

  • Cleanse – Use a gentle cleanser to wash away any dirt, grime, excess oil, or residue from the skin. Look for cleansers with fewer ingredients and those formulated specifically for sensitive skin.
  • Toner – Yes, people with sensitive skin should still use a toner. Toner helps to improve the skin’s pH balance, remove any stubborn oils or residue, and generally improve skin tone and clarity. Many toners are formulated with astringents like alcohol that can irritate sensitive skin, so look for products that are mild or formulated specifically for sensitive skin.
  • Serums & Treatments – Apply any recommended serums and treatments for specific skin concerns (signs of aging, dark spots, acne, eczema, etc.). For sensitive skin, good serums may be formulated to address your specific skin sensitivity symptoms like redness, puffiness, or irritation.
  • Moisturize – Apply an ample amount of one of our recommended facial moisturizers.
  • Sunscreen – Don’t skip the sunscreen. Sensitive skin can be especially prone to damage or irritation caused by sun exposure, so minimize any issues related to UVA and UVB damage by applying a broad-spectrum sunscreen with SPF 30 or higher.

Your Sensitive Skin PM Skincare Routine

  • Cleanse – You can use the same gentle cleaners in the morning and evening.
  • Toner – If your sensitive skin tends to be very dry, you may not need to use toner twice a day. You may not even need to use it every day. Pay attention to your skin and apply toner in either the morning or evening if you notice your skin feels too dry or it gets irritated.
  • Serums – Nighttime serums are all about soothing and healing the damage from your day. Look for products that repair the skin’s natural barrier, boost moisture, and soothe inflammation and irritation.
  • Moisturizers – Apply a good moisturizer that will boost your skin’s hydration overnight.
